Make a genuine impact supporting elementary students in a center-based program dedicated to learners with intellectual disabilities, many of whom utilize assistive communication devices. This contract role offers the opportunity to support growth and development across a vibrant K-5 student population in a dynamic and collaborative environment. The position is conveniently located near Strasburg, CO, with a consistent Monday through Friday schedule.
Key Qualifications:
- Master’s degree in Speech-Language Pathology or equivalent
- Current state licensure (or eligibility) as an SLP in Colorado
- Previous school-based or pediatric SLP experience highly valued
- Strong knowledge of assistive communication devices and tools
- Outstanding communication, organization, and documentation abilities
- Compassionate, flexible, and collaborative approach working with multidisciplinary teams
- Commitment to enhancing student access, participation, and communication
Primary Responsibilities:
- Conduct formal and informal assessments to identify student speech, language, and communication needs
- Participate in IEP meetings to develop individualized education plans and document progress
- Deliver both direct and indirect speech-language therapy per each student’s IEP
- Adapt supports and interventions for students with intellectual disabilities
- Collaborate closely with teachers, paraprofessionals, and families to implement best practices
- Maintain accurate records and fulfill all required documentation
- Caseload to be determined during the interview based on program needs and candidate expertise
